The crash happened on the northbound carriageway at around 11.30am (January 10) near junction 26 in Orrell.
The motorway has been reduced to just one lane between junctions 27 (Standish) and 26 (Orrell), whilst police deal with the incident.

Highways said it expects the lane closures to remain in effect until around 1.30pm.
No injuries have been reported and North West Ambulance Service said they had not been called to the scene.
A spokesman for Highways said: "Following a road traffic accident on the M6 between J26 (Orrell) and J27 (Standish), there is a lane closure in place.

UPDATE - 1.15pm - Highways confirm that this incident is now clear and recovery has been completed.
